A fruit vendor at the local farmer’s market sells apples for $0.89 each and bananas for $0.51 each. A customer buys A apples and B bananas, and has $35.00 to spend. Determine which answer choice represents the following expression in this context using appropriate units of measure. What does the expression 35.00 − (0.89A + 0.51B) represent?
